Deva
Person過去仏スジャータの上首弟子で、友人スダッサナと共にその仏の最初の説法を受けた祭司の息子。
The leading disciple (aggasāvaka) of Sujāta Buddha. He was a chaplain’s son, and the Buddha’s first discourse was addressed to him and his friend Sudassana (J.i.38; BuA.168, 170). He is also called Sudeva (Bu.xiii.25).
